The Tesla Gen 3 Wall Connector With 7.3m Cable by Tesla Energy is a convenient charging solution for Tesla and non-Tesla electric vehicles. The Tesla Energy 1529455-02-F has a lightweight design that allows for versatile, indoor or outdoor mounting, adapting to a range of electrical systems. It is compatible with all EVs with a Type 2 charge port and comes with a 7.3m cable. The Tesla Energy 1529455-02-F can provide up to 71km of range per hour and up to 22 kW with three-phase charging grids.

Works With All Electric Car Makes And Models

The handle is standard Type 2, so it isn’t Tesla-only. Every electric car sold new in Australia uses that same fitting, so a Volvo, a Polestar, a Kia, or a BYD charges from this unit exactly the way a Tesla does. If you change cars in a few years, the charger on the wall will still fit.

Key Features

  • Residual current detection, Type A plus DC 6mA. Detection of DC fault current is built into the charger, so your board does not need the more expensive protective device an EV circuit would otherwise call for.
  • No ventilation requirement. It can go into a closed garage, a store, or a cupboard without an air path designed around it.
  • Firmware delivered over 2.4GHz Wi-Fi. Improvements reach the unit on their own, so the charger you own in three years is not frozen on the version that shipped in the box.
  • 6.8kg including the wirebox, at 345 x 155 x 110mm. It goes onto a stud or masonry wall without any structural work behind it.

The wirebox mounts and gets wired before the charger goes onto it, so the unit itself is never left hanging exposed through the rest of the job.

Will it charge a car that isn’t a Tesla?

Yes. The Type 2 fitting is what every EV sold new in Australia uses, so a Kia, Volvo, BYD, or Polestar plugs straight in and charges the same way a Tesla does. What’s Tesla-only is the app integration, not the charging.

How fast will it actually charge my car?

That depends on your car as much as the charger. The Wall Connector delivers up to 32A, but every EV has its own limit on how fast it will accept a charge, and Tesla notes that some of its own vehicles draw less than the maximum. The supply into your house sets the ceiling too, and the heavier one gives you more. Either way it’ll cover a normal day’s driving overnight. We’ll confirm what your place can support before you buy.

Can I install the Wall Connector myself?

No, and it isn’t a grey area. It needs its own branch circuit and dedicated breaker wired into your switchboard, which is licensed electrical work in Queensland. Tesla also rules out adapters and extension leads entirely. Doing it yourself voids the warranty and fails an insurance claim.

Will it survive on an outside wall?

Yes. It’s IP55 and IK08 rated, and Tesla specifically says it doesn’t need caulking. Mount it between 0.6m and 1.52m off the ground outdoors. Around 1.15m is the comfortable height for handling the cable.

What happens if I get a second EV later?

Group Power Management handles it. A second Wall Connector shares the same circuit and the two split the available power automatically, so you don’t need a switchboard upgrade just to add a car. Worth mentioning at quote stage, because it’s cheaper to allow for the cable run now.
